MORGENFORMAT: Danish Design Award

Date: September 24th
Time: 8.30 - 9.30
Location: Designmuseum Danmarks café, Bredgade 68, 1260 København K, Denmark

Event organized by Danish Design Center & Design denmark.

After a year’s break, the Danish Design Award is back. The awards will be presented in November, but at MORGENFORMAT at Designmuseum Danmark you can get an exclusive sneak peek at this year’s shortlisted designers and future design trends. You’ll be in the company of Tirza Lambæk, Creative Director of the Danish Design Centre and Henrik Lübker, Director of Design denmark. Together, the two organisations are behind the Danish Design Award.

As something completely new, the award has removed all previous categories and instead the jury judges based on the five design values: Do no harm, Pursue beauty, Lead the way, Prove your impact and Solve problems worth solving. These values are also something that will be rounded up for this MORGENFORMAT.
